Metre Per Second is Hyderabad's most experienced independent specialist for Volkswagen and Skoda DSG (Direct Shift Gearbox) repair. We work on every DSG variant sold in India over the last 15 years — DQ200 (7-speed dry-clutch in Polo, Vento, Rapid, Virtus, Slavia, Kushaq 1.0/1.5 TSI), DQ250 (6-speed wet-clutch in older Octavia, Yeti, Jetta, Superb 1.8/2.0 TSI), DQ381 (7-speed wet-clutch in current Octavia, Superb, Tiguan, Kodiaq, Karoq) and DQ500 (7-speed wet-clutch AWD in Tiguan AllSpace and certain Kodiaq diesels). Most workshops in Hyderabad mis-diagnose DSG problems as "gearbox failure" and quote ₹3.5–6 lakh for a full unit replacement. In reality, the vast majority of DSG faults — jerky take-off, gear-1 to gear-2 flare, P17BF / P189C / P0810 / P073B fault codes, "Gearbox malfunction — please consult workshop" warning, kangaroo low-speed shifting, slipping under load — are caused by a failed mechatronic unit (the hydraulic + electronic valve body that controls the clutches), worn clutch packs, leaking accumulators or a software adaptation that has drifted out of range. We use ODIS Service / ODIS Engineer with the genuine VAS 6154 interface, perform live data capture of clutch K1 / K2 pressures, request torque data, basic settings and clutch adaptation runs, and only after a definitive diagnosis do we recommend mechatronic rebuild, clutch pack replacement or full DQ-unit replacement. We stock genuine OE mechatronic units, LuK clutch kits (DQ200 dry, DQ250 / DQ381 / DQ500 wet), genuine VW G 052 182 / G 055 529 / G 060 162 DSG fluids and the correct K1 / K2 piston seals.

Common VW & Skoda DSG / Mechatronics Problems We Fix

DQ200 7-Speed Dry-Clutch Judder & Take-Off Jerk

The DQ200 dry-clutch DSG fitted to Polo / Vento / Rapid / Virtus / Slavia / Kushaq commonly develops a judder or kangaroo-jump from a standstill, especially in Hyderabad traffic. Most often caused by glazed dual-clutch friction discs and a worn mechatronic accumulator.

Symptoms:

  • Shudder pulling away from rest
  • "Gearbox malfunction" warning
  • Hesitation between 1st and 2nd
  • P17BF / P189C / P0810 / P0841 fault codes
  • Loss of drive after few seconds in D

Solution: ODIS clutch adaptation, mechatronic accumulator replacement (genuine VW), and if confirmed by clutch wear data, dry dual-clutch K1+K2 pack replacement with LuK kit + new flywheel as needed

DQ250 / DQ381 Wet-Clutch Slip & Mechatronic Pressure Loss

The DQ250 (6-spd wet) and DQ381 (7-spd wet) used on Octavia, Superb, Tiguan and Kodiaq develop K1 / K2 clutch slip and mechatronic valve body wear. Causes flare during 2-3 / 3-4 upshifts, particularly under load.

Symptoms:

  • RPM flare on upshift
  • Burning smell after spirited driving
  • P0841 / P073B / P17D7 fault codes
  • Limp mode in higher gears
  • Sudden loss of drive

Solution: Genuine Pentosin / VW DSG fluid + filter change first; if slip persists, mechatronic rebuild (replace K1+K2 pressure regulator solenoids, position sensors and accumulators) and wet dual-clutch pack replacement

Mechatronic Unit Failure — All DSG Variants

The mechatronic (TCM + electro-hydraulic valve body) is the brain of the DSG. Failed pressure regulator solenoids, leaking accumulators or burned-out clutch position sensors throw P189A / P189C / P17BF / P0700 codes and put the gearbox into limp mode.

Symptoms:

  • "Gearbox malfunction" or "Stop, gearbox fault" warning
  • Stuck in 5th / no drive at all
  • P189A, P189C, P17BF, P0700, P0871 codes
  • No reverse engagement
  • TCM not communicating on bus

Solution: ODIS-confirmed mechatronic diagnosis, then: (a) mechatronic rebuild with genuine Bosch / Continental solenoid kit, OR (b) genuine OE replacement mechatronic with full ODIS coding, basic settings and clutch adaptation. We always quote both options

DQ500 AWD Tiguan / Kodiaq Harsh Shifting & Haldex Confusion

The DQ500 7-spd wet DSG in Tiguan AllSpace 4Motion and Kodiaq L&K diesel can throw harsh shifts that get blamed on the gearbox but are actually caused by a stuck Haldex clutch or a worn DSG fluid.

Symptoms:

  • Crash into 1st when stopping
  • Driveline shudder cornering at low speed
  • P189C / P17BF + Haldex DTCs together
  • Loud thud during low-speed reverse
  • Reduced AWD bias

Solution: Diagnose Haldex clutch and DSG independently — Haldex pump screen + filter clean + Haldex fluid, plus genuine DQ500 fluid + filter change (12 L), mechatronic re-adaptation

Our Diagnostic & Repair Process

  1. Genuine ODIS Scan: Full DTC + freeze frame read with VAS 6154 + ODIS Service. Capture TCM SW version, gearbox part number, hardware revision and complete fault history.
  2. Live Clutch Data Capture: Read K1 / K2 actual vs requested pressure, clutch position sensor voltage, gear engagement times, clutch temp and torque request — full 30-minute live log under city + highway driving.
  3. Clutch Adaptation & Basic Settings: Run the official VW basic-settings procedure 062 / 063 / 067 / 068. If adaptation completes within tolerance, the clutches are within wear limits.
  4. Mechatronic Pressure Test: External hydraulic pressure-tap test on the mechatronic to verify K1, K2 and main line pressures are within Bosch spec at idle and under torque request.
  5. Repair Plan & Quote: Three-tier quote: (a) fluid + filter + adaptation, (b) mechatronic rebuild, (c) full mechatronic + clutch replacement. Customer decides based on data, not guesswork.

Is the DQ200 dry-clutch DSG reliable in Hyderabad traffic?

It is reliable IF the fluid is changed every 60,000 km, the clutch adaptation is performed every 30,000 km, and the car is not creep-driven for hours in stop-start traffic. We have customers with 2 lakh km on original DQ200 clutches because of disciplined service. Most failures we see come from skipped service intervals.

Can you reset "Gearbox malfunction — please consult workshop"?

Only after we have read the underlying DTCs and fixed the root cause. Clearing the warning without repair will simply re-trigger it within minutes of driving. We do not offer "code clear and go" service for safety reasons.
